"Inhalation Exposure" is a descriptor in the National Library of Medicine's controlled vocabulary thesaurus,
MeSH (Medical Subject Headings). Descriptors are arranged in a hierarchical structure,
which enables searching at various levels of specificity.
The exposure to potentially harmful chemical, physical, or biological agents by inhaling them.
